Nvidia became the first company to surpass a $5 trillion valuation in October, a milestone that reflects its central role in the artificial intelligence boom. The chip designer’s rise reshapes the pecking order in global tech and adds heat to a race that now touches data centers, energy grids, and geopolitics.

The feat puts Nvidia ahead of Apple and Microsoft, long the standard-bearers of market value. It also marks a shift in what investors reward. Hardware built for AI training and inference is now the market’s main engine, and Nvidia sits at the core of that surge.

How Nvidia Reached the Mark

Nvidia’s ascent began with graphics processors used in gaming. Those same chips proved well-suited for training large AI models. As cloud platforms and AI labs scaled up, demand for Nvidia’s data center products soared. The company built a full stack: chips, networking, and software tools that became standard across the industry.

Major buyers include OpenAI’s partners, large cloud providers, and social platforms building their own models. Orders for accelerators have booked out quarters in advance, tightening supply. Investors chased that momentum, pushing shares to fresh highs through the year.

The AI Chip Arms Race

Competition is rising. Advanced Micro Devices and Intel are racing to win share in AI accelerators, while large customers develop custom silicon. Google’s TPUs, Amazon’s Trainium and Inferentia, and Microsoft’s Maia and Cobalt chips aim to reduce reliance on a single supplier.

Analysts say Nvidia’s lead rests on performance, developer tools, and an ecosystem that speeds up deployment. Still, rivals are closing gaps in cost and efficiency. For customers, more choice could ease shortages and pricing pressure.

  • Nvidia leads in high-performance accelerators used for training large models.
  • Cloud providers push custom chips to lower costs and secure supply.
  • Chip packaging and networking are now as important as raw compute.

Investor Euphoria and Risks

The $5 trillion mark reflects soaring expectations for AI revenue across search, productivity tools, and enterprise software. Bulls see years of data center buildouts and new services that can justify heavy spending on chips and infrastructure.

But there are risks. Growth could slow if customers pause spending to optimize existing capacity. Concentration on a few big buyers makes results sensitive to their budgets. A shift to cheaper inference hardware, or better software efficiency, could also trim unit demand.

Some portfolio managers warn that past chip cycles saw sharp swings. They point to valuation measures that price in strong growth for a long time. Supporters counter that AI adoption is still early and spreads across many sectors, from healthcare to automotive.

Supply, Power, and Policy Constraints

Scaling AI requires more than chips. Advanced packaging, high-bandwidth memory, and fiber networking remain tight. Foundry partners and memory suppliers are rushing to add capacity, but lead times can stretch roadmaps.

Power is another pinch point. New data centers require vast electricity and cooling, prompting utilities and operators to plan new generation and grid upgrades. Some regions now weigh rules on siting, water use, and emissions tied to large facilities.

Policy shapes the market as well. Export controls limit shipments of top-end accelerators to some countries. That creates regional product variants and complicates supply chains. Governments court chip investment at home with subsidies and tax credits, seeking security and jobs.

What It Means for Tech Giants

Nvidia’s rise resets league tables long dominated by consumer hardware and software platforms. Apple and Microsoft remain giants with deep cash flows and loyal users. Their push into AI services could still define how consumers and workers use the technology.

For now, the market is rewarding the picks-and-shovels supplier of the AI rush. If customers keep scaling models and deploying AI across products, infrastructure spending may continue to flow to accelerators and related gear.

The next phase will test durability. Watch for new chip launches, shifts in buyer mix, and signs of supply relief. Track power projects and regulatory moves that could speed or slow data center buildouts. Most of all, watch whether AI services deliver clear gains that justify the hardware spend.

Nvidia’s $5 trillion milestone signals that the center of gravity in tech has shifted to compute for AI. The question now is how long demand can outrun constraints—and how quickly rivals and customers reshape the field.
